Job Summary:The Nurse Practitioner in Women’s Health OB/GYN will provide comprehensive healthcare services to women during all stages of life, with a focus on obstetric and gynecologic care. Working collaboratively with physicians and the healthcare team, this role encompasses diagnostic assessments, treatment planning, preventive care, and patient education.
Job Duties & Responsibilities:
- Conduct comprehensive and episodic health assessments, developing individualized patient care plans.
- Diagnose, treat, and manage acute and chronic conditions, including prenatal, postpartum, and general gynecological care.
- Order and interpret diagnostic and therapeutic tests and coordinate follow-up care.
- Provide primary and specialty care services, including well-woman exams, contraceptive counseling, STI testing and treatment, and referrals as needed.
- Collaboratively manage antenatal and postnatal care in partnership with physicians or midwifery colleagues.
- Offer health promotion, disease prevention, and wellness education.
- Collaborate with the inter-disciplinary team to ensure holistic, patient-centered care.
- Maintain accurate and confidential medical records, adhering to professional and legal standards.
- Stay current on research and evidence-based practices in women’s health OB/GYN.
- Provide empathetic guidance and support, addressing patient concerns about their health and treatment options.
